ChemSpider 2D Image | 2-{4-fluoro-2-[(2R,5R)-5-{[(5-fluoropyridin-2-yl)oxy]methyl}-2-methylpiperidine-1-carbonyl]phenyl}pyrimidine | C23H22F2N4O2

2-{4-fluoro-2-[(2R,5R)-5-{[(5-fluoropyridin-2-yl)oxy]methyl}-2-methylpiperidine-1-carbonyl]phenyl}pyrimidine

  • Molecular FormulaC23H22F2N4O2
  • Average mass424.443 Da
  • Monoisotopic mass424.171082 Da
  • ChemSpider ID34955779
  • defined stereocentres - 2 of 2 defined stereocentres

Predicted data is generated using the ACD/Labs Percepta Platform - PhysChem Module, version: 14.00

Density: 1.3±0.1 g/cm3
Boiling Point: 524.3±50.0 °C at 760 mmHg
Vapour Pressure: 0.0±1.4 mmHg at 25°C
Enthalpy of Vaporization: 79.8±3.0 kJ/mol
Flash Point: 270.9±30.1 °C
Index of Refraction: 1.571
Molar Refractivity: 110.8±0.3 cm3
#H bond acceptors: 6
#H bond donors: 0
#Freely Rotating Bonds: 5
#Rule of 5 Violations: 0
ACD/LogP: 2.73
ACD/LogD (pH 5.5): 2.65
ACD/BCF (pH 5.5): 60.34
ACD/KOC (pH 5.5): 654.90
ACD/LogD (pH 7.4): 2.65
ACD/BCF (pH 7.4): 60.35
ACD/KOC (pH 7.4): 654.98
Polar Surface Area: 68 Å2
Polarizability: 43.9±0.5 10-24cm3
Surface Tension: 48.4±3.0 dyne/cm
Molar Volume: 337.4±3.0 cm3
